Etymology: The term "unconformability" emerges from the geological sciences, specifically in the context of stratigraphy, where it describes a significant discontinuity in the geological record. This concept is vital for understanding the history of the Earth, as it signifies a period during which sedimentation ceased, often due to erosion or tectonic activity, leading to a gap in the geological timeline. The formal coining of the term can be traced back to the late 19th century, reflecting a growing interest in the Earth's stratified layers and the processes that shape them. The word itself is formed from the prefix "un-", indicating negation, and "conformability," which derives from the Latin "conformare," meaning "to form or shape together." This root emphasizes the idea of layers of rock or sediment that do not conform to the expected pattern of deposition. In geological terms, conformable layers are those that are deposited without interruption, while unconformable layers indicate a break in this sequence, leading to an important distinction in the study of Earth's history. The evolution of this term reflects a broader shift in geological thinking that began in the 18th and 19th centuries, as scientists started to recognize that the Earth's history was not a straightforward, continuous process. Instead, it is marked by periods of stability and upheaval. This shift was influenced by pioneers like James Hutton and Charles Lyell, who advocated for a more dynamic understanding of geological processes. The introduction of "unconformability" into the scientific lexicon was a way to articulate these observations, providing a framework for interpreting the complex history recorded in the rock layers.
